SNVformer: An Attention-based Deep Neural Network for GWAS Data
2022-07-10
Abstract excerpt
Despite being the widely-used gold standard for linking common genetic variations to phenotypes and disease, genome-wide association studies (GWAS) suffer major limitations, partially attributable to the reliance on simple, typically linear, models of genetic effects.
